mirror of
https://github.com/DSpace/dspace-angular.git
synced 2025-10-07 10:04:11 +00:00
[TLC-674] Mock duplicateDataService.findDuplicates()
This commit is contained in:
@@ -15,7 +15,7 @@ import { Item } from '../../../../core/shared/item.model';
|
|||||||
import { ClaimedSearchResultListElementComponent } from './claimed-search-result-list-element.component';
|
import { ClaimedSearchResultListElementComponent } from './claimed-search-result-list-element.component';
|
||||||
import { ClaimedTask } from '../../../../core/tasks/models/claimed-task-object.model';
|
import { ClaimedTask } from '../../../../core/tasks/models/claimed-task-object.model';
|
||||||
import { WorkflowItem } from '../../../../core/submission/models/workflowitem.model';
|
import { WorkflowItem } from '../../../../core/submission/models/workflowitem.model';
|
||||||
import { createSuccessfulRemoteDataObject } from '../../../remote-data.utils';
|
import { createSuccessfulRemoteDataObject, createSuccessfulRemoteDataObject$ } from '../../../remote-data.utils';
|
||||||
import { ClaimedTaskSearchResult } from '../../../object-collection/shared/claimed-task-search-result.model';
|
import { ClaimedTaskSearchResult } from '../../../object-collection/shared/claimed-task-search-result.model';
|
||||||
import { TruncatableService } from '../../../truncatable/truncatable.service';
|
import { TruncatableService } from '../../../truncatable/truncatable.service';
|
||||||
import { VarDirective } from '../../../utils/var.directive';
|
import { VarDirective } from '../../../utils/var.directive';
|
||||||
@@ -41,9 +41,11 @@ mockResultObject.hitHighlights = {};
|
|||||||
const emptyList = createSuccessfulRemoteDataObject(createPaginatedList([]));
|
const emptyList = createSuccessfulRemoteDataObject(createPaginatedList([]));
|
||||||
const itemDataServiceStub = {
|
const itemDataServiceStub = {
|
||||||
findListByHref: () => observableOf(emptyList),
|
findListByHref: () => observableOf(emptyList),
|
||||||
|
|
||||||
};
|
};
|
||||||
const duplicateDataServiceStub = {
|
const duplicateDataServiceStub = {
|
||||||
findListByHref: () => observableOf(emptyList),
|
findListByHref: () => observableOf(emptyList),
|
||||||
|
findDuplicates: () => createSuccessfulRemoteDataObject$({}),
|
||||||
};
|
};
|
||||||
|
|
||||||
const item = Object.assign(new Item(), {
|
const item = Object.assign(new Item(), {
|
||||||
|
@@ -15,7 +15,7 @@ import { Item } from '../../../../core/shared/item.model';
|
|||||||
import { PoolSearchResultListElementComponent } from './pool-search-result-list-element.component';
|
import { PoolSearchResultListElementComponent } from './pool-search-result-list-element.component';
|
||||||
import { PoolTask } from '../../../../core/tasks/models/pool-task-object.model';
|
import { PoolTask } from '../../../../core/tasks/models/pool-task-object.model';
|
||||||
import { WorkflowItem } from '../../../../core/submission/models/workflowitem.model';
|
import { WorkflowItem } from '../../../../core/submission/models/workflowitem.model';
|
||||||
import { createSuccessfulRemoteDataObject } from '../../../remote-data.utils';
|
import { createSuccessfulRemoteDataObject, createSuccessfulRemoteDataObject$ } from '../../../remote-data.utils';
|
||||||
import { PoolTaskSearchResult } from '../../../object-collection/shared/pool-task-search-result.model';
|
import { PoolTaskSearchResult } from '../../../object-collection/shared/pool-task-search-result.model';
|
||||||
import { TruncatableService } from '../../../truncatable/truncatable.service';
|
import { TruncatableService } from '../../../truncatable/truncatable.service';
|
||||||
import { VarDirective } from '../../../utils/var.directive';
|
import { VarDirective } from '../../../utils/var.directive';
|
||||||
@@ -43,6 +43,7 @@ const itemDataServiceStub = {
|
|||||||
};
|
};
|
||||||
const duplicateDataServiceStub = {
|
const duplicateDataServiceStub = {
|
||||||
findListByHref: () => observableOf(emptyList),
|
findListByHref: () => observableOf(emptyList),
|
||||||
|
findDuplicates: () => createSuccessfulRemoteDataObject$({}),
|
||||||
};
|
};
|
||||||
|
|
||||||
const item = Object.assign(new Item(), {
|
const item = Object.assign(new Item(), {
|
||||||
|
Reference in New Issue
Block a user